摘要: Maedi-visna virus (MVV) is an ovine lentivirus that is widespread in many countries worldwide. Both clinical and subclinical MVV infections cause substantial economic losses. MVV infection in live sheep is usually diagnosed serologically, with antibody-positive sheep being regarded as infected. There have been few reports of maedi-visna in China, with no detailed epidemic analysis of MVV infection in ovine herds. In order to investigate the seroprevalence and spatial distribution of maedi-visna among ovine flocks in China, a total of 672 serum samples were collected from different ovine flocks in 12 regions (provinces, autonomous regions or municipalities) of China in 2011, and serum antibody levels were determined using a commercial ELISA Kit. This study represents the first investigation of the seroepidemiology of maedi-visna in China, indicating a circulation of MMV among sheep.
